About the Opportunity:
As part of our amazing marine team, deckhands will assist with docking and undocking, ensuring guest comfort and safety while underway, and maintaining the appearance and cleanliness of the vessel. Experience in this field is not required; we will provide training. All that is required is an eagerness to learn and a strong work ethic. This entry level position could lead to a career in the maritime industry. Shipmates must uphold the strictest safety standards for guests & crew and always maintain a professional and friendly manner.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ities:
- Stand look-out watch in ships bow, stern, or bridge to look for obstructions in a ships path
- Handle lines to moor vessels to pier
- Maintain uniform and personal grooming in compliance with appearance standards
- Maintain the cleanliness and safety of all common areas
- Assist with general maintenance on vessel
- Provide exceptional hospitality to guests and coworkers as prescribed in our RESPECT Service System
- Participate in routine safety & emergency preparedness drills
- Be prepared to begin work at scheduled time
- Complete maintenance projects and repair work within the timeframe assigned, and inform management of all progress, delays, and/or challenges.
- Follow safety procedures to ensure the protection of passengers, crew, and the vessel
- Load or unload materials such as trash from vessel
- Welcome guests on the vessel with the highest level of customer service
- Additional job duties as assigned.
Requirements & Qualifications:
- Must be at least sixteen (16) years of age
- Must be able to throw mooring lines from ship to pier
- Must have normal color vision to interpret navigational lights and color-sensitive systems & safety displays
- High School diploma or equivalent
- Will work for extended periods of time without sitting
- Strong focus on safety and teamwork while actively looking for ways to help others
- Must be able to lift fifty (50) pounds; moving furniture & other heavy items such as provisions up and down stairs
- Receptive to working nights/weekends and major holidays
- Per US Coast Guard regulations, must be a US Citizen or a Permanent Resident
- Must be able to effectively understand and convey written and verbal information to guests and coworkers
